You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@cocoon.apache.org by Paul Russell <pa...@luminas.co.uk> on 2000/11/29 22:00:05 UTC

[Patch] Re: [C2] NullPointerException (command line operation)

On Wed, Nov 29, 2000 at 02:28:39PM -0500, Berin Loritsch wrote:
> I get this from the command line.  It happens when you try
> to get a Cocoon.RESPONSE_OBJECT from the Map objectModel
> passed to the browserSelector.  During servlet execution,
> the browserSelector works fine.

Hrm. Strange - it's definately set. Can you send me your generated
sitemap?

> This also happens during xsp/simple.xsp execution.
> 
> C:\projects\xml-cocoon\dist\cocoon-2.0a3>run -l logs/cocoon.log -u DEBUG -c D:\WebSphere\AppServer\hosts\default_host\ePos\web
> xsp/simple.xsp
> java.lang.NullPointerException
> java.lang.NullPointerException
>         at org.apache.cocoon.transformation.XalanTransformer.setup(XalanTransformer.java:182)
>         at org.apache.cocoon.sitemap.ResourcePipeline.process(ResourcePipeline.java:181)
>         at _D_._WebSphere._AppServer._hosts._default_host._ePos._web._sitemap_xmap.error_process_1(_sitemap_xmap.java:1893)
>         at _D_._WebSphere._AppServer._hosts._default_host._ePos._web._sitemap_xmap.process(_sitemap_xmap.java:1858)
>         at org.apache.cocoon.sitemap.Handler.process(Handler.java:132)
>         at org.apache.cocoon.sitemap.Manager.invoke(Manager.java:87)
>         at org.apache.cocoon.Cocoon.process(Cocoon.java:239)
>         at org.apache.cocoon.Main.warmup(Main.java:287)
>         at org.apache.cocoon.Main.main(Main.java:192)

Patch attached.

> The error page generated has this exception:
> 
> java.lang.RuntimeException: org.apache.cocoon.environment.commandline.CommandLineRequest.getParameterValues(String name) method not
> yet implemented!
>  at org.apache.cocoon.environment.commandline.CommandLineRequest.getParameterValues(CommandLineRequest.java:115)
>  at org.apache.cocoon.components.language.markup.xsp.XSPRequestHelper.getParameterValues(XSPRequestHelper.java:121)
>  at _D_._WebSphere._AppServer._hosts._default_host._ePos._web._docs._samples._xsp._simple_xsp.generate(_simple_xsp.java:470)
>  at org.apache.cocoon.generation.ServerPagesGenerator.generate(ServerPagesGenerator.java:143)
>  at org.apache.cocoon.sitemap.ResourcePipeline.process(ResourcePipeline.java:201)
>  at _D_._WebSphere._AppServer._hosts._default_host._ePos._web._sitemap_xmap.process(_sitemap_xmap.java:1581)
>  at org.apache.cocoon.sitemap.Handler.process(Handler.java:132)
>  at org.apache.cocoon.sitemap.Manager.invoke(Manager.java:87)
>  at org.apache.cocoon.Cocoon.process(Cocoon.java:239)
>  at org.apache.cocoon.Main.getPage(Main.java:409)
>  at org.apache.cocoon.Main.processURI(Main.java:338)
>  at org.apache.cocoon.Main.processURI(Main.java:330)
>  at org.apache.cocoon.Main.process(Main.java:297)
>  at org.apache.cocoon.Main.main(Main.java:193)

... Which is fair enough as far as I can see -- the command line
environment doesn't support parameters, and that page specifically
uses them.


Paul

-- 
Paul Russell                               <pa...@luminas.co.uk>
Technical Director,                   http://www.luminas.co.uk
Luminas Ltd.

Re: [Patch] Re: [C2] NullPointerException (command line operation)

Posted by Giacomo Pati <gi...@apache.org>.
Patch applied.

Giacomo

Paul Russell wrote:
> 
> On Wed, Nov 29, 2000 at 02:28:39PM -0500, Berin Loritsch wrote:

<snip/>

> > This also happens during xsp/simple.xsp execution.
> >
> > C:\projects\xml-cocoon\dist\cocoon-2.0a3>run -l logs/cocoon.log -u DEBUG -c D:\WebSphere\AppServer\hosts\default_host\ePos\web
> > xsp/simple.xsp
> > java.lang.NullPointerException
> > java.lang.NullPointerException
> >         at org.apache.cocoon.transformation.XalanTransformer.setup(XalanTransformer.java:182)
> >         at org.apache.cocoon.sitemap.ResourcePipeline.process(ResourcePipeline.java:181)
> >         at _D_._WebSphere._AppServer._hosts._default_host._ePos._web._sitemap_xmap.error_process_1(_sitemap_xmap.java:1893)
> >         at _D_._WebSphere._AppServer._hosts._default_host._ePos._web._sitemap_xmap.process(_sitemap_xmap.java:1858)
> >         at org.apache.cocoon.sitemap.Handler.process(Handler.java:132)
> >         at org.apache.cocoon.sitemap.Manager.invoke(Manager.java:87)
> >         at org.apache.cocoon.Cocoon.process(Cocoon.java:239)
> >         at org.apache.cocoon.Main.warmup(Main.java:287)
> >         at org.apache.cocoon.Main.main(Main.java:192)
> 
> Patch attached.
>